Transaction 40783ac8bfb76457d5926730778c45b24033f10368b727ffb15e739b2bbc4897

1 Input
2 Outputs
  • 40783ac8bfb76457d5926730778c45b24033f10368b727ffb15e739b2bbc4897:0
  • value  18638100
    address  3KDVRLgo8e4WpkP7oFhzou3jPijUvVRQxR
  • 40783ac8bfb76457d5926730778c45b24033f10368b727ffb15e739b2bbc4897:1
  • value  3938400
    address  3MjCNdX2HyEDpKgKLMyHcHfkdgpmZ1m7CU